Automating Outbound Sales: Definition, Tools, and Tips

Outbound sales automation involves leveraging cutting-edge tools and technologies to simplify repetitive, time-intensive tasks in the outbound sales workflow. This covers everything from pinpointing potential clients to managing initial outreach and follow-up efforts.

Through software solutions, sales teams can refine their processes, cut down on manual labor, and shift their attention to critical activities like fostering client relationships and sealing the deal with prospects.

Outbound sales automation stands apart from inbound automation. Inbound automation concentrates on refining processes to draw in and connect with prospects already curious about your offerings. Conversely, outbound automation takes the initiative, targeting individuals who haven’t yet engaged with your brand, using tactics like cold email campaigns, automated calls, and diverse outreach methods to spark leads, cultivate connections, and fuel sales growth.

Why Opt for Outbound Sales Automation?

Having grasped the essence of outbound sales automation, let’s dive into the compelling reasons to adopt it for your sales approach.

1. Manual prospecting saps time and efficiency

Endlessly repeating tedious tasks squanders time and stifles efficiency. Sales reps often dedicate hours to manual chores—digging into prospect details, sorting leads, and handling admin duties—leaving them with just 28% of their week for real selling.

Worse yet, you might pour effort into manually curating a list only to secure zero meaningful meetings. Automating these steps removes the grunt work, freeing you to zero in on impactful pursuits like uncovering promising leads and locking in deals.

2. Missed follow-ups and bland messages hurt results

Truth be told, your sales reps aren’t skipping follow-ups on purpose. They’re swamped, managing 50+ prospects daily with unique demands, which wears them thin. Those overlooked follow-ups aren’t mere slip-ups—they’re lost chances that stall your revenue.

Automation steps in to save the day, delivering timely, tailored messages at the perfect point in a prospect’s journey. By tapping into multi-channel outreach—like LinkedIn or phone calls—teams can keep communication steady and lift conversion odds.

3. Sporadic outreach equals lost sales

Imagine this: a deal you assumed fizzled out last quarter might’ve died due to patchy outreach. Maybe your reps sent two follow-ups when five are usually needed to get a reply. Or perhaps prospects tuned out because your generic emails didn’t spark interest.

Human factors—think workload or mood swings—can throw outreach off track. Automation steadies the ship, streamlining campaigns across emails, calls, or LinkedIn, ensuring no deal slips away.

4. Tracking and tuning performance is tough without automation

A hands-on sales process leaves you blind to what’s working. If a tactic’s lagging by 30%, you might never notice. Which subject lines grab attention? Which follow-ups seal the deal? These remain enigmas without data.

Automation lifts the veil with clear, actionable insights. You’ll see what shines, what flops, and where to tweak, sharpening your outreach with precision.

5. Disconnected tools slow you down

If your reps are manually shuffling data between CRMs, email systems, or dialers, they’re bogged down and prone to mistakes. A clunky workflow frustrates them and lets opportunities vanish.

Automation bridges these gaps, syncing data smoothly across platforms to ramp up efficiency. No more dropped details costing you cash—your operations hum along seamlessly.

Core Features of a Strong Outbound Sales Automation Setup

1. Tools for lead discovery and enhancement

“I’ve got to research first” is a costly phrase for any salesperson. This isn’t a quick search—it’s slogging through LinkedIn profiles, piecing together contacts, or guessing emails, draining productivity.

While finding and enriching leads is vital for a solid pipeline, doing it manually is a slog. Automation software handles this at scale—gathering, sorting, and ranking leads to supercharge your efforts.

2. Mass Personalization: Templates, tags, and adaptive content

Your reps are trapped—either crafting custom emails that eat hours or firing off generic blasts that get ignored. Meanwhile, rivals use smart automation to personalize at scale.

Outbound automation turns personalization into a science, forging real prospect bonds. With variables, dynamic pages, or tags, it crafts messages that hit home, targeting specific needs.

3. Email Chains and Smart Follow-Up Rules

With prospects needing 12+ touchpoints, manual outreach is a time sink. Thankfully, automation tools lighten the load, managing communication across channels with ease.

From tailored emails to multi-step sequences, these systems keep key prospects in play. If someone checks your pricing page post-email, it can fast-track the sequence and flag a rep to step in.

4. Call Streamlining and Dialer Sync

Automation can’t take over calls entirely, but it can boost your team’s game. It cuts out phone lookups, busy tones, and dead ends.

These tools refine cold calling, recording talks and jotting notes for later. They also deliver insights to guide sharper call decisions.

5. CRM with Task Tracking and Auto-Triggers

Even top teams drop balls when juggling tons of emails or calls daily. These slip-ups cost millions yearly.

A CRM with automation triggers builds smart workflows that act at the right moment. It logs interactions automatically, and if a prospect hits your site thrice, it pings your reps with a custom follow-up plan.

6. Analytics, Split Testing, and Interaction Monitoring

Guessing at sales tactics is risky—data should drive you. Test every piece—subject lines, copy, scripts, channels—for real results.

Automation gives you pinpoint insights, showing what resonates per segment. Plus, campaign tracking highlights wins and weak spots.

Top Outbound Sales Automation Tools

Here are five standout tools to power up your outbound sales game.

1. Apollo.io – Top Pick for All-in-One Lead Hunting and Outreach

Apollo.io

Use Case: Need one tool for lead finding, data boosting, and multi-channel outreach (email, calls, LinkedIn)? Apollo.io fits sales leaders, execs, marketers, and ops teams scaling up.

Key Features:

– Vast B2B database with 65+ filters for sharp targeting

– Unified email, LinkedIn, and call sequences

– Tracking and analytics to hone performance

– LinkedIn Chrome extension for easy sourcing

Pricing: Starts at $59/month after a free trial.

2. Close CRM – Best for Call-Heavy Teams

CloseCrm.com

Use Case: Perfect for teams big on cold calling, Close CRM offers fast dialing and automation for high-contact outreach.

Key Features:

– Power and predictive dialers to speed calls

– Email and SMS automation

– Smart Views to prioritize tasks

– Full reporting for team insights

Pricing: Begins at $49/month.

3. Lemlist – Great for Scaled, Personal Cold Emails

Lemlist.com

Use Case: Lemlist shines at crafting custom cold emails with dynamic content, keeping deliverability strong.

Key Features:

– Custom images and videos for standout emails

– Warm-up tools for inbox health

– Multi-channel sequences (email, LinkedIn, calls)

– A/B testing and campaign stats

Pricing: Starts at $69/month post-trial.

4. Instantly.ai – Ideal for Mass Cold Email Campaigns

Instantly.ai

Use Case: Built for sending 5,000+ emails monthly across many inboxes, Instantly.ai manages deliverability and scale.

Key Features:

– Handles 100+ inboxes in bulk

– Auto warm-up and deliverability scoring

– B2B lead finder for quality lists

– Team tools for coordinated efforts

Pricing: From $37/month.

5. Salesloft – Best for Big Teams with Deep Analytics

Use Case: Suited for mid-to-large teams needing structured cadences and Salesforce sync, Salesloft offers robust insights.

Key Features:

– Multi-channel cadences (email, calls, social)

– Call coaching and conversation tools

– Native Salesforce integration

– Detailed performance dashboards

Pricing: Quote-based.

Mistakes to Dodge in Outbound Sales Automation

While automation brings big wins, watch out for these pitfalls.

1. Too Much Automation Kills Personal Touch

Overdoing it can churn out stiff, generic messages prospects ignore. Shallow AI personalization fatigues people—human oversight keeps it real.

2. Skipping Email Domain Warm-Up

Blasting emails without warming domains lands them in spam. Tools like Instantly.ai can prep your accounts, boosting trust and delivery rates.

3. Weak Targeting from Bad Data

Your system’s only as good as its data. Junk info misfires outreach, wasting effort. Keep lists fresh and accurate.

4. No CRM Integration

Unsynced tools clog your workflow with manual entry, risking lost insights. Seamless integration keeps deals on track.

5. Ignoring Metrics and Responses

Skipping data analysis misses chances to optimize. Tracking opens and replies fine-tunes your approach.

Outbound Sales Automation FAQs

1. How Do I Keep Automation Personal?

Mix automation with human flair. Let tools handle sequences, but lean on reps for relationships and tricky talks like negotiations.

2. Sales Engagement Platforms vs. CRMs?

Engagement platforms boost prospect interactions; CRMs store data to map the buyer’s path.

3. Can Automation Tank Email Deliverability?

Yes, if sloppy—think mass sends without warm-up. Done right, it lifts delivery and engagement.

4. How Do I Gauge Automation Success?

Watch metrics like lead volume, quality, sales cycle speed, and close rates to measure impact.
